Study Summary

RATIONALE: Drugs used in chemotherapy work in different ways to stop tumor cells from dividing so they stop growing or die. Radiation therapy uses high-energy x-rays to damage tumor cells. It is not yet known whether chemotherapy is more effective with or without radiation therapy in treating patients who have rhabdomyosarcoma. PURPOSE: Phase III trial to compare the effectiveness of chemotherapy with or without radiation therapy in treating patients who have newly-diagnosed rhabdomyosarcoma.

Interventions

  • DRUG cyclophosphamide
  • BIOLOGICAL filgrastim
  • BIOLOGICAL sargramostim
  • BIOLOGICAL dactinomycin
  • DRUG vincristine sulfate
